Key Responsibilities
- Team up with Fulfillment and Receiving Managers to hunt down and fix operational bottlenecks and discrepancies
- Receive and sort incoming boxes and pallets by SKU and PO number, following our SOPs like a pro to keep everything shipshape
- Print and stick SKU labels with precision, then transform soft goods (like apparel) using folding machines, visual checks, and packing into their designated bins - because presentation matters!
- Skillfully use warehouse management systems, scan guns, and mobile scanners to move products and keep our inventory spot on.
- Conduct quality control inspections and dive into discrepancy investigations with a sharp eye and problem-solving mindset.
- Perform pick and pack tasks, product transfers, staging, dock duties, waste disposal, and general warehouse support - ready to pitch in wherever the action is!
- Keep leadership in the loop with clear, timely communication using our tried-and-true methods.
- Hit your KPIs consistently and show up on time, every time - being reliable is key!
- Always be learning and sharing feedback on our inventory systems and processes so we can keep improving together

Requirements:Qualifications
- High school diploma, GED, or equivalent certification.
- At least 1 year of hands-on experience in fulfillment, shipping, receiving, picking, or order fulfillment.
- Comfortable with physical work - standing, bending, lifting up to 50 lbs, and working in cozy or tight spaces for long stretches.
- Confident using scan guns, printers, handheld scanners, and common warehouse gear like pallet jacks.
- Computer savvy with basic Office 365 skills; experience with ShipHero is a bonus!
